After getting my PGWP, I initially worked as a Customer Service Rep for about 5 months. Later I joined a different company and took on a completely different role, Project Accountant and I have been working here for 8 months now. Can I add these two job and count it as 12 months experience to apply under CEC?

If your first job was a skilled job (i.e. it falls under NOC 0/A/B) and you gained it after you successfully completed your program of studies, then yes you can count that as qualifying work experience for CEC. For more information on CEC please click on the below CIC link found in my signature.

are you sure it was NOC A? Most "customer service" positions are classified as skill level C, and a quick search of NOCs using the term "customer service" does not come up with any NOC A positions...
